On Thursday, September 25th, we have a very special Thursday night project and we really need about 10 to 15 experienced detailers to attend.


We're looking for people that are experienced with machine polishing, all types of machine polishing including,

  • Porter Cable - Griot's Garage - Meguiar's G110v2 - Simple dual action polishers.
  • Flex 3401 Forced Rotation Dual Action Polishers
  • Rupes Bigfoot Orbital Polishers
  • Cyclo Orbital Polishers
  • Rotary Buffers
